Transaction 35a6a6823626347437402adee7e0cd31f0133392ad0a5813ce2456380353601b

2 Input
2 Outputs
  • 35a6a6823626347437402adee7e0cd31f0133392ad0a5813ce2456380353601b:0
  • value  1454657
    address  3EWFhqZLxPFpZ2T47oLxrF3JW5MkWPuWwR
  • 35a6a6823626347437402adee7e0cd31f0133392ad0a5813ce2456380353601b:1
  • value  3558319
    address  1Kv77CNgXgJKivZyqej43yNWiVYqQKmCoK